Algorithmic Beauty: Digital Representations
In the realm within digital art, algorithmic aesthetics has emerged as a captivating phenomenon. Artists harness computational algorithms to generate stunning images, pushing the boundaries between traditional artistic practice. These processes often analyze and interpret vast datasets of human features, resulting in unique visual outcomes. From stylized representations to abstract explorations of the human figure, algorithmic aesthetics offers a fascinating window into the intersection between art, technology, and perception.
- Moreover, the flexibility of algorithms allows artists to innovate with varied aesthetic approaches.
- As a result, algorithmic portraits often question our conventions about beauty and depiction.
